{ "info": { "author": "GISCE-TI, S.L.", "author_email": "devel@gisce.net",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"License :: OSI Approved :: GNU Affero General Public License v3",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.5", "Topic :: Utilities" ], "description": "iec870ree\n=========\n\n.. image:: https://travis-ci.com/gisce/iec870ree.svg?branch=master\n :target: https://travis-ci.com/gisce/iec870ree \n\n.. image:: https://coveralls.io/repos/github/gisce/iec870ree/badge.svg?branch=master\n :target: https://coveralls.io/github/gisce/iec870ree?branch=master\n\n\t \n\nIEC-870-5-102 for REE Spanish Electric meters\n\nDocumentation about this protocol:\n\n- `Initial definition `_\n- `Extension `_\n\n\nInstallation\n------------\n\n.. code-block::\n\n $ pip install iec870ree\n\n\nConfiguration of devices:\n\n- `GSM `_\n- `RTC `_\n\n\nImplemented ASDUs \n-----------------\n\n- C_AC_NA_2: Authentication (Already implemented on origin)\n- C_CI_NU_2: Read integrated totals **incremental** values (Already implemented on origin)\n- M_IT_TK_2: Answer to C_CI_NU_2 (Already implemented on origin)\n- C_CI_NT_2: Read integrated totals **absolute** values\n- M_IT_TG_2: Answer to C_CI_NT_2\n- C_FS_NA_2: Finish session (Already implemented on origin)\n- C_TI_NA_2: Read current date and time\n- M_TI_TA_2: Answer to C_TI_NA_2\n- C_RD_NA_2: Read manufacturer and device identifiers\n- P_MP_NA_2: Answer to C_RD_NA_2\n- C_TA_VC_2: Read metering information **Current values**\n- M_TA_VC_2: Answer to C_TA_VC_2\n- C_TA_VM_2: Read metering information **Saved values**\n- M_TA_VM_2: Answer to C_TA_VM_2\n- C_CB_UN_2: (optional) Read integrated totals **incremental** values. With blocks choices. Similar to C_CI_NU_2.\n- M_IB_TK_2: Answer to C_CB_UN_2\n\nHistory of this project\n-----------------------\n\nInitial project was writen by `Javier de la Puente `_\nand was called `reeprotocol `_ .\nThen `GISCE-TI `_ started working on it and implemented\n`Ip Layer `_,\n`base changes `_\nand `new ASDUs `_.\nWith that we put this library in production \ud83d\ude80! Our working speed was different\nfrom the main repo pace so we started a new project forked from the original.\nYou can see the issue with the history `here `_.", "description_content_type": "text/x-rst",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/gisce/iec870ree", "keywords": "", "license": "GNU Affero General Public License v3", "maintainer": "", "maintainer_email": "", "name": "iec870ree", "package_url": "https://pypi.org/project/iec870ree/", "platform": "", "project_url": "https://pypi.org/project/iec870ree/", "project_urls": { "Homepage": "https://github.com/gisce/iec870ree" }, "release_url": "https://pypi.org/project/iec870ree/0.2.0/", "requires_dist": null, "requires_python": "", "summary": "Library to connect and query information about electricmeters following REE protocol.", "version": "0.2.0" }, "last_serial": 4893795,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"421008ddf116080e914f073fb1a3365f", "sha256": "73fc8ee02e5c37050d9b7c0293eeec81ef707139ffe62948838ba51313209dc7" }, "downloads": -1, "filename": "iec870ree-0.1.0.tar.gz", "has_sig": false, "md5_digest": "421008ddf116080e914f073fb1a3365f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24709, "upload_time": "2018-08-22T09:34:17", "url": "https://files.pythonhosted.org/packages/52/3b/4f2fc2ad0a11fe7198a3d2f26912ed357f4963bdfd45bf337381a595c2b2/iec870ree-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"5f34e36e11265ab7bb1b43d377565b9b", "sha256": "7dacc1c14f228732fccaba52baace51c0e34acc5b4eb5bf62ef64222458d7036" }, "downloads": -1, "filename": "iec870ree-0.1.1.tar.gz", "has_sig": false, "md5_digest": "5f34e36e11265ab7bb1b43d377565b9b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24776, "upload_time": "2018-08-22T10:03:03", "url": "https://files.pythonhosted.org/packages/40/cc/025d4165aaa5f7eaf0de06a138469d805e21461abb297019df39d5c1cf7c/iec870ree-0.1.1.tar.gz" } ], "0.1.2": [ { "comment_text": "", "digests": { "md5": "8eb10a448b2939b9a2cd6f8a74756a23", "sha256": "6694bd57cc9310f19a906bcc75f0f575410d35cb479438e5db50798ffc9da9e7" }, "downloads": -1, "filename": "iec870ree-0.1.2.tar.gz", "has_sig": false, "md5_digest": "8eb10a448b2939b9a2cd6f8a74756a23",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24778, "upload_time": "2018-10-23T07:03:15", "url": "https://files.pythonhosted.org/packages/10/c5/cccceeeb97e24d324e335e5993563d5cb20ccbfc973b4d28e0a197dac3b7/iec870ree-0.1.2.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"d2453ba65f701bcb6dcd5283726efc4f", "sha256": "860a7dcc3c05fb923f6382fb3fa007369bd8316617c82f016e8ef8632b6ac734" }, "downloads": -1, "filename": "iec870ree-0.2.0.tar.gz", "has_sig": false, "md5_digest": "d2453ba65f701bcb6dcd5283726efc4f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24773, "upload_time": "2019-03-04T10:37:31", "url": "https://files.pythonhosted.org/packages/c8/c9/a8c95d165eb117132cfec6f389842238660b768ea4b07fb6e54c7de0faf8/iec870ree-0.2.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"d2453ba65f701bcb6dcd5283726efc4f", "sha256": "860a7dcc3c05fb923f6382fb3fa007369bd8316617c82f016e8ef8632b6ac734" }, "downloads": -1, "filename": "iec870ree-0.2.0.tar.gz", "has_sig": false, "md5_digest": "d2453ba65f701bcb6dcd5283726efc4f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 24773, "upload_time": "2019-03-04T10:37:31", "url": "https://files.pythonhosted.org/packages/c8/c9/a8c95d165eb117132cfec6f389842238660b768ea4b07fb6e54c7de0faf8/iec870ree-0.2.0.tar.gz" } ] }